Multiple effects of nitrate amendment on the transport, transformation and bioavailability of antimony in a paddy soil-rice plant system.

•Kinetics of sb in paddy soil with adding nitrate was controlled multiple effects.•Proton consumption via denitrification could enhance Sb(V) mobility.•The redox cycling of fe and s could diversely affect sb availability.•Arsenite-oxidizing marker gene aoxB may be involved in Sb(III) oxidation.
